본문 바로가기

Android

안드로이드 OS 구조 안드로이드 OS 는 이미 많은 스마트폰에 사용되고있죠. 안드로이드OS는 처음 안드로이드사에서 개발한것인데 구글에서 인수하면서 더 개발되어 보급된것입니다. 구글이 인수하기 전에 안드로이드사에서 삼성과 LG를 찾아갔었다는데 거절당했다고 하더군요.. 그때 삼성에서 잡았더라면 바다OS를 따로 만들필요가 없었을텐데 안타까운면도 있습니다. 그후 우리나라에는 2010년 2월 모토로라의 모토로이가 안드로이드 스마트폰으로 첫 모습을 보였습니다. 안드로이드 OS는 리눅스 기반으로 리눅스 2.6 커널을 기반으로하여 오픈 소스 소프트웨어입니다. 그래서 많은 제조사들이 이용하고 있죠 그리고 iOS와는 다르게 개발이 자유롭습니다. iOS는 개발자 신청을 해야하는데 연간 일정의 돈을 지불해야 합니다. 안드로이드는 Linux Ker.. 더보기
안드로이드 빌드(build.prop) 목록 안드로이드에서 build.prop은 ID 카드 같은거죠 스마트폰 /system 폴더 안에 존재하는 파일로 기기의 sdk버전, 제조사명, 제품모델명, 커널 버전, 등 여러 정보를 담고있습니다. 루팅후 이 build.prop파일을 이용해서 약간의 성능을 향상시키는 방법이 많습니다. 기기마다 다를수 있지만 대부분 공통적인것이기 때문에 올립니다. #는 주석으로 해당 줄은 인식하지 못합니다. 만약 해당되는 트윅이 없으시면 추가하시고 있으시면 변경하셔야 합니다. 중복될경우 폰에 소프트웨어 적으로 문제가 생길수도 있습니다. 루팅은 필수입니다! #UI 렌더링을 GPU에 할당 debug.sf.hw=1 #기기가 idle 상태일때 최저전압 pm.sleep_mode=1 ro.ril.disable.power.collapse=0.. 더보기